Assured Space Debuts CapLink Array: A Phased Array Leap for Missile Defense and Aerospace Communications
Assured Space Access Technologies Inc., a veteran-owned RF systems innovator, has unveiled its CapLink Array, a next-generation phased array antenna system engineered to elevate missile defense radar and space communications. Announced from Chandler, Arizona, the CapLink Array is designed to meet the growing demands of multi-domain operations, offering wide bandwidth, high gain, and rapid threat-tracking capabilities across contested environments.
For aerospace and defense professionals, this launch represents a significant advancement in phased array technology, with potential applications ranging from hypersonic missile detection to high-speed satellite communications and synthetic aperture radar (SAR) imaging.
Capacitive Innovation Meets Tactical Precision
At the heart of the CapLink Array is a proprietary capacitive dipole element design arranged in a novel configuration. This architecture enables broad frequency coverage and exceptional gain performance, allowing radar systems to detect and track multiple threats simultaneously with enhanced speed and precision.
The system supports real-time threat detection for missile defense, wide-area surveillance for ground-based radar, and high-resolution SAR for surface mapping. It also offers space situational awareness capabilities, including orbital debris tracking and satellite monitoring, critical functions as low-Earth orbit becomes increasingly congested.
Bridging Defense and Commercial Space
Beyond its defense applications, the CapLink Array is engineered for high-speed satellite communications, delivering data rates up to 3.5 Gbps with potential for even higher throughput using advanced ground equipment. Integrated transponders and polarization diversity further enhance its versatility, making it suitable for both secure military networks and commercial SATCOM deployments.
The system’s compatibility with software-defined radios ensures seamless integration with existing command and control architectures, a key consideration for aerospace contractors managing legacy systems alongside next-gen platforms.
Manufacturing Momentum and Market Demand
The launch coincides with Assured Space’s investment in its Phased Array Center of Excellence in Melbourne, Florida, a facility dedicated to advancing RF antenna systems and secure 5G architectures. The center is positioned to help address a global backlog of more than $30 billion in defense and commercial contracts, underscoring the urgency and scale of demand for advanced phased array solutions.
Founded in 2001, Assured Space has built a reputation for delivering mission-ready RF payloads, scalable zero-trust 5G systems, and custom sensors for multi-orbit satellite communications. With operations across the U.S., the company is well-positioned to support aerospace primes and integrators seeking reliable, high-performance antenna systems.
